My father, who had a Prudential life insurance poilicy, died in 2005. Upon his death I contacted Prudential with his social security number, policy number, and name. Prudential swore that they had no valid policy and I had no claim. I contacted them again in 2006. Then in 2007. Finally, at the end of 2012, they were able to locate their paperwork. Then they lost the check. Each time I tried to trace it, I was transferred to an outsourced call center in the Philippines where they couldn’t find anything and had no power to do anything. Today, I called Jonathan Graybill’s office(current vice president). But, more than seven years after my father’s death, I’m still waiting for Prudential to stop messing up.
